What sequence of events led to the Renaissance?

Following the Black Death and Middle Ages, people wanted a change. As Italian city-states grew through trade and commerce, they flourished economically and intellectually. This led to a revived interest in the art, social, scientific, and political ideas of ancient Greece and Rome.

What techniques were introduced in painting and sculpture during the Renaissance?

Artists began using perspective, depth and proportion to make their art appear more realistic. They also started using more colors.

What differences in religious beliefs brought about the Reformation?

Some people believed that the church had become corrupt and should not be allowed to sell indulgences. They also believed that individuals should interpret the bible themselves. Others believed that the Pope or other church officials could interpret the Bible. This led some people to leave the Roman Catholic Church

How did European colonization expand the slave trade?

Many times there were not enough colonists to perform all the work in the colony. As a result, Europeans in the Americas often forced native people to work for them or brought in slaves from Africa to provide labor.
